π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

12 items
  • 3 pieces ripe bananas
  • 100 grams granulated sugar
  • 50 grams brown sugar
  • 75 grams unsalted butter
  • 2 pieces large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 200 grams all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on baking soda
  • 0.25 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 50 milliliters milk

πŸ“ Instructions

11 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 375Β°F (190Β°C) and line a 12-cup muffin tin with paper liners or lightly grease with non-stick cooking spray.

2

In a large mixing bowl, mash the ripe bananas with a fork until smooth.

3

Add the granulated sugar, brown sugar, and melted unsalted butter to the mashed bananas. Mix well until combined.

4

Beat in the eggs one at a time, followed by the vanilla extract, and stir until smooth.

5

In a separate b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t, and ground cinnamon.

6

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, stirring gently until just combined. Do not overmix.

7

Stir in the milk to loosen the batter slightly for a smooth consistency.

8

Divide the batter evenly among the muffin cups, filling each about 3/4 full.

9

Bake in the preheated oven for 18-22 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center of a muffin comes out clean.

10

Remove the muffins from the oven and allow them to cool in the tin for 5 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.

11

Serve warm or at room temperature. Enjoy your delicious banana muffins!

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(78.8g)
Calories
199
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 6.3 g 8%
Saturated Fat 3.6 g 18%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.0 g
Cholesterol 45 mg 15%
Sodium 153 mg 7%
Total Carbohydrate 33.0 g 12%
Dietary Fiber 1.3 g 5%
Total Sugars 16.5 g
Protein 3.3 g 7%
Vitamin D 0.3 mcg 1%
Calcium 20 mg 2%
Iron 0.9 mg 5%
Potassium 151 mg 3%

*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
